mase123987

New member
Mar 1, 2012
3,118
0
0
Visit site
Well the article did say it should be released by the 28th, today. Might just be a little behind. I haven't heard anything new.
 

Members online

Forum statistics

Threads
323,241
Messages
2,243,504
Members
428,047
Latest member
EyeTea